Output 44510668079443d284976c27aab4300a91227d0328839f36e3ace220b726f35d:1

value
3790602911
script pubkey
OP_0 OP_PUSHBYTES_20 b131329eb3bac0fc27f4e3761207aeeae966d3c1
address
tb1qkycn984nhtq0cfl5udmpypawat5kd57pr88lur
transaction
44510668079443d284976c27aab4300a91227d0328839f36e3ace220b726f35d
confirmations
107811
spent
true